Review Process

Your submitted manuscript will be review process, this Journal applies the Double-Blind Review model to maintain confidentiality. The editor first checks every script that is submitted, if the article meets the focus and scope and guidelines for writing this Journal the plagiarism element is not more than 20 percent, the manuscript is continued to the reviewer to review the content and novelty of the paper, if not then the article will be returned to the author. A minimum of two reviewers will examine each paper for six weeks with the criteria for evaluating the manuscript, as stated in the Article Rating Form for Reviewers.

Beware of Multiple Submissions

JAIIT Editorial Board will not tolerate unfortunate situations when authors submit the same, or nearly identical, manuscript to more than one journal. In such cases:

  • the manuscript in question will be immediately rejected,
  • other manuscripts of the same authors/co-authors currently under review will be returned, and
  • the main author and co-authors will be prohibited from new submissions to the Journal for at least one calendar year.
